How do I view a project in NetBeans?
From Netbeans 7.1 onwards, just click the Window button on the top bar and select the window you want, for example: Projects. Alternatively, you can click CTRL + (A number from 1 to 7) and a tab with the selected information will open. For example, clicking CTRL + 1 will open the Projects tab.

How do I open multiple windows in NetBeans?
And here is how to do it:
- Right-click on the NetBeans IDE shortcut and choose “Properties”.
- In the shortcut tab, under Target, type after netbeans.exe “–userdir [Ruta de la carpeta]”.
- Create another NetBeans IDE shortcut and provide a different folder path.

How do I run a downloaded project in NetBeans?
8 answers
- Open Netbeans.
- Click File > New Project > JavaFX > JavaFX with Existing Sources.
- Click Next.
- Name the project.
- Click Next.
- Under Source Package Folders, click Add Folder.
- Select the nbproject folder below the zip file you want to upload (Note: you must unzip the folder)
- Click Next.

How to share a Java project in NetBeans?
Right click on your project and choose to create a new folder. Name it lib and press OK. You will be able to see the folder if you go to the Files tab. Then put (copy) your libraries there. Then go back to the projects tab and right click on the libraries node. Choose to add JAR/Folder and point to where the jar you want to use is (inside the lib folder).

How to get team server fonts in NetBeans?
Choose Team > Team Server > Get Feeds from the main menu to open the Get Team Server Feeds wizard. Alternatively, you can open a Team Server project in the Team Dashboard and then click Get under the Project Sources node in the Team Dashboard.
